Talent Acquisition Specialist – US Marketplace Operations

Role Overview

As a Talent Acquisition Associate, you will play a critical role in scaling Pepper’s creator and content talent ecosystem, with a strong focus on US hiring across freelance, contract, and full-time roles.

This role goes beyond traditional recruiting. You’ll work closely with creator acquisition, content operations, and business teams to build, manage, and sustain a high-quality creator network aligned with Pepper’s brand, quality standards, and growth goals. If you enjoy hiring at scale, working with freelancers and creators, and thinking strategically about talent pipelines — this role is for you.

Roles &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end recruitment for freelance, contract, and full-time content & creative roles, with a strong focus on US marketplace
  • Collaborate closely with content, operations, marketing, and leadership teams to align hiring with business goals
  • Manage the selection process, including conducting interviews, assessing candidates’ skills and qualifications, and making data-driven hiring decisions aligned with Pepper Content’s values and goals.
  • Support creator community management, engagement, and retention initiatives
  • Develop and maintain process documentation, SOPs, style guides, and onboarding frameworks to enable scalable hiring
  • Use hiring data and insights to improve turnaround time, quality, and overall recruitment efficiency

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in Talent Acquisition, preferably hiring freelancers, creators, or content talent
  • Hands-on experience managing US or global hiring across freelance and full-time roles
  • Strong understanding of Creator Acquisition and Talent Management
  • Experience hiring across US, UK, APAC, or EMEA markets is a plus
  • Ability to manage multiple roles and stakeholders in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ong communication, stakeholder management, and candidate experience skills
  • Data-driven mindset with the ability to analyze hiring trends and optimize processes
  • Genuine interest in the creator economy, content operations, and scaling high-quality talent networks

Please note: This is on-site role based in Mumbai (Marol) at US shift, 3:00pm – 12:00am.
